Probiotic Supplements Explained
Probiotic supplements have become a popular way to maintain gut health, boost immunity, and improve various bodily functions. Understanding what probiotics are, their benefits, and how to choose the right one can help you make informed decisions about your health. Here’s a detailed guide on probiotic supplements.
What are Probiotics?
Probiotics are live microorganisms, primarily bacteria, which are similar to beneficial microorganisms found in the human gut. They are often referred to as "good" or "helpful" bacteria because they help keep the gut healthy.
Benefits of Probiotic Supplements
Probiotic supplements offer a range of health benefits:
- Improved Digestive Health: They can help balance the friendly bacteria in your digestive system to prevent and treat diarrhea, especially following antibiotic use.
- Enhanced Immune System: By maintaining gut health, probiotics play a crucial role in modulating the immune system.
- Healthy Skin: Certain probiotics have been shown to help with skin conditions such as eczema.
- Mental Health: Emerging research suggests a link between gut health and mood and mental health. Probiotics can play a role in promoting a healthy mind.
Types of Probiotic Supplements
Probiotic supplements come in various forms, each containing different types and strains of bacteria. The most common types include:
- Lactobacillus: This is the most common probiotic and is found in yogurt and other fermented foods. It’s beneficial for diarrhea and may help those who cannot digest lactose.
- Bifidobacterium: Found in some dairy products, it may help ease symptoms of irritable bowel syndrome (IBS) and other conditions.
- Saccharomyces boulardii: A yeast probiotic used to treat and prevent diarrhea.
Choosing the Right Probiotic Supplement
When selecting a probiotic supplement, consider the following:
- Strain Specificity: Different strains serve different purposes. It’s important to choose a probiotic that has the strains that meet your health needs.
- CFU Count: Probiotic potency is measured in colony-forming units (CFUs). A higher CFU count often means a more effective probiotic, depending on the specific health concern.
- Quality and Purity: Opt for supplements from reputable brands that have undergone third-party testing to ensure potency and purity.
How to Use Probiotic Supplements
To get the most out of probiotic supplements, follow these tips:
- Consistency: Take your probiotic supplement regularly for best results.
- Storage: Some probiotics need to be kept in the fridge to maintain their effectiveness.
- Timing: Taking probiotics on an empty stomach or before meals may improve their effectiveness.
